What temperature do you cook prime rib in the oven?
Insert a meat thermometer into the center of the roast. Cook the prime rib in a 450 F oven for about 20 minutes. Then reduce the oven temperature to 350 F and continue cooking until the desired internal temperature is met. Remove the roast from the pan and loosely tent with aluminum foil to keep it warm while it rests.
What temperature should I cook a standing rib roast?
Rub the meat with salt and pepper. Roast on a rack in a shallow pan for 25 minutes. 3. Reduce the oven temperature to 350°F and roast for 16 minutes per pound (about 1 3/4 hours), or until a meat thermometer reaches an internal temperature of 135°F to 140°F for a medium-rare center.

When to take prime rib out of oven?
Ideally, you want to remove the meat from the oven or grill when the temperature reaches 120-125°F (rare) and let it rest for about 20 to 30 minutes before slicing. This allows the meat to rise a few degrees in temperature to reach your preferred degree of doneness.
How long do you cook a rib roast in the oven?
Roast 30 minutes, then reduce heat to 350º and cook 1 hour 30 minutes more for medium rare. (Plan on about 15 minutes per pound.) Remove roast from oven, cover with foil, and let rest 20 minutes. To serve, slice along ribs to remove them, then separate each rib and put them aside. Slice the roast crossways against the grain.

What is the best cut for prime rib?
The top tier of beef is labeled “prime,” but it is rarely available to home cooks. The best cuts of beef for a roast are the tenderloin, rolled rib roast and standing rib roast. Other cuts that roast well include the strip loin, top loin, bottom sirloin, eye round, top round and sirloin tip.
